Gary Robert Broge, known to all his friends and family as Cork, passed peacefully surrounded by loved ones on November 15 after a courageous battle with cancer. Cork was born in 1939 in Monroe, WI, one of ten siblings. After high school he joined the Air Force, serving at bases in the US and Canada from 1957-1962. Upon his return home to Monroe, he began working for Brennan’s Market, a journey that would continue for more than five decades. He married Judith Ann Noll on November 28th, 1964, and moved to her hometown of Madison. The following year he helped open Brennan’s first Madison location on University Avenue where, as the longtime manager, he was much loved for his good-natured personality. Cork and Judy spent much of their leisure time at their cottage in Pardeeville, WI, where they loved boating and their long fireside chats with neighbors. They also enjoyed escaping the Wisconsin winters to the warmer climes of Florida and Texas. But their greatest joy was spending time with their two beloved grandsons.
